The origins of **how to rinse nose with salt water** trace back over 5,000 years to the Indian subcontinent, where Ayurvedic healers prescribed *jala neti* as part of the *Shatkarmas*—six cleansing practices for detoxification. Ancient texts like the *Charaka Samhita* described using warm, filtered water mixed with a pinch of salt to "purify the nasal passages and clear the mind." The practice wasn’t just about physical health; it was tied to spiritual clarity, with yogis believing a clear nasal passage allowed for better breath control during meditation. By the 19th century, European physicians adopted similar techniques, though with a focus on treating respiratory infections. The term "nasal douche" entered medical lexicon, and saltwater rinses became a staple in hospitals for postoperative care. The modern neti pot, as we recognize it today, was popularized in the West in the 1970s by yoga instructors and alternative medicine advocates. The efficacy of **how to rinse nose with salt water** stems from its dual action: **osmotic balance** and **physical flushing**. Isotonic saline (0.9% salt concentration) mirrors the body’s natural fluids, preventing irritation while drawing excess fluid from swollen tissues. This reduces inflammation without the drying effects of hypertonic solutions (higher salt concentrations). Meanwhile, the mechanical flow of water dislodges mucus, bacteria, and allergens trapped in the nasal passages—particles that would otherwise trigger immune responses or worsen congestion. The nasal cavity’s anatomy plays a crucial role. The turbinates (bony structures lined with mucus membranes) create turbulence that traps particles. When you tilt your head and allow the saline to flow through, it mimics the body’s natural drainage system, clearing the sinuses from the front to the back. This is why proper technique—starting with the head tilted to one side—is essential. The solution should enter one nostril and exit the other, bypassing the throat entirely. Poor form can lead to water entering the Eustachian tubes (connecting the nose to the ears), risking infection or vertigo.Key Benefits and Crucial Impact

Q: Can I use tap water for rinsing my nose with salt water?
A: No. Tap water may contain bacteria or parasites (like *Naegleria fowleri*, the "brain-eating amoeba") that can cause severe infections. Always use **sterile or boiled-and-cooled distilled water**, or pre-mixed saline packets designed for nasal irrigation.
Q: How often should I rinse my nose with salt water?
A: For general maintenance, 3–4 times weekly is ideal. During allergy season or active congestion, daily rinses (morning and evening) can provide relief. Overuse (more than twice daily) may irritate nasal tissues, so monitor your body’s response.
Q: What’s the best salt concentration for rinsing?
A: **Isotonic saline (0.9% salt)** is safest for most people. To make it at home, dissolve ¼ teaspoon of non-iodized salt and ¼ teaspoon of baking soda in 8 ounces of warm water. Hypotonic (lower salt) solutions may sting, while hypertonic (higher salt) can dry out nasal passages.
Q: Can children use nasal rinses?
A: Yes, but with caution. Children under 2 should avoid rinses due to risk of ear infections. For ages 2–5, use a **bulb syringe with low-volume saline** and supervise closely. Older kids can try squeeze bottles with guidance on proper head positioning.
Q: Does rinsing help with sinus infections?
A: While it won’t cure bacterial sinusitis (which often requires antibiotics), **how to rinse nose with salt water** can reduce symptoms by thinning mucus and flushing out pathogens. It’s most effective for viral infections, allergies, or chronic sinusitis as an adjunct therapy.
Q: Can I rinse my nose if I have a deviated septum?
A: Yes, but you may need to adjust technique. Lean toward the side with the **less obstructed nostril** to ensure proper drainage. If congestion persists, consult an ENT to rule out structural issues requiring intervention.
Q: What’s the best time of day to rinse?
A: Morning rinses help clear overnight mucus buildup, while evening rinses can ease congestion for better sleep. For allergies, rinse **after** outdoor exposure to remove pollen. Avoid rinsing right before bed if you’re prone to postnasal drip.
Q: Are there any risks or side effects?
A: When done correctly, risks are minimal. Potential issues include **nasal irritation, sneezing, or mild bleeding** (from overuse or aggressive rinsing). Rarely, improper technique can cause ear discomfort or infection. If you experience dizziness or severe pain, stop immediately and consult a doctor.
Q: Can I add essential oils or herbs to my saline rinse?
A: Avoid adding oils or herbs unless they’re **pharmaceutical-grade and FDA-approved for nasal use**. Some oils (like tea tree or eucalyptus) can irritate nasal tissues, while others may trigger allergies. Stick to plain saline unless directed by a healthcare provider.
Q: How do I clean my neti pot to prevent bacterial growth?
A: After each use, rinse the pot with **hot water and mild soap**, then air-dry upside down. Soak it weekly in a **vinegar-water solution (1:1 ratio)** to kill bacteria. Never share your neti pot, and replace it every **3–6 months** or if cracks appear.
